What leads to premature suspension wear in the 2017 Tesla Model S, and how to resolve it?

Factors Leading to Premature Suspension Wear
 

 
Poor Road Conditions
 

  • Potholes, uneven surfaces, and other road hazards can put undue stress on the suspension components.
  • Frequent driving on poorly maintained roads accelerates wear and tear.

 
Aggressive Driving
 

  • Rapid acceleration, hard braking, and aggressive cornering increase the load on suspension parts.
  • This driving style can cause components to wear out faster than normal.

 
Overloading
 

  • Consistently carrying heavy loads can strain the suspension system beyond its capacity.
  • This excessive weight leads to faster deterioration of suspension parts.

 
Improper Alignment
 

  • Incorrect wheel alignment can cause uneven tire wear, which negatively impacts the suspension.
  • Misalignment can also cause abnormal stress on suspension components.

 
Inadequate Maintenance
 

  • Neglecting regular maintenance checks can cause minor suspension issues to escalate.
  • Failing to lubricate or replace worn-out parts as needed shortens the lifespan of the suspension system.

 
Defective Parts
 

  • Occasionally, premature wear might be due to manufacturing defects in the suspension components themselves.
  • Using substandard replacement parts can also contribute to early wear.

 
Solutions to Resolve Premature Suspension Wear
 

 
Drive Cautiously
 

  • Avoid aggressive driving behaviors such as rapid acceleration and hard braking. Drive smoothly to minimize stress on the suspension system.
  • Slow down when driving over potholes and rough roads to reduce impact on suspension components.

 
Proper Maintenance and Inspections
 

  • Regularly inspect the suspension system during routine maintenance checks to identify and address issues early.
  • Lubricate suspension parts as required and replace worn or damaged components promptly.

 
Main Current Wheel Alignment
 

  • Perform alignment checks and adjustments as per the manufacturer's recommendations to ensure that your wheels are correctly aligned.
  • Proper alignment helps to distribute the load evenly across all suspension parts, preventing uneven wear.

 
Avoid Overloading
 

  • Adhere to the vehicle’s load capacity specifications to avoid excessive strain on the suspension system.
  • If you frequently carry heavy loads, consider upgrading the suspension to stronger components suited for higher loads.

 
Use Quality Parts
 

  • Replace worn suspension components with high-quality, O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ts to ensure durability and performance.
  • Consult with authorized Tesla service centers for recommended parts and services.

 
Address Manufacturer Defects
 

  • If you suspect premature suspension wear is due to defective parts, consult with Tesla for warranty repair or replacement options.
  • Stay updated on any recalls or technical service bulletins related to suspension issues.
